The Irish Caves Database records Pollskeheenarinky at Skeheenaranky in County Tipperary. This point comes from its public cave register. A cave map point does not by itself grant access: check local conditions and ask the landowner where needed.
The cave register does not grant public access. Check conditions and ask the landowner before entering private land.
